As the new Premier League season draws nearer by the day, the Hammers support are eagerly waiting to see if the club are able to add anyone else to the squad before the summer transfer window slams shut at midnight on 9 August.
With a plethora of signings already completed, could there possibly be room for one more?
According to the news source, the Guardian the answer could, quite possibly be yes.
Our referenced source is running with the inference that West Ham are amongst a number of clubs who are looking to sign the Brazilian winger, Bernard.
The 25-year-old, who has 14 Brazil caps to his name, is currently a free agent after leaving Shakhtar Donetsk at the end of last season.
Bernard, when previously approached is said to have wanted a weekly salary circa £200,000 a week.
